Police arrest masquerader suspected of flogging female nurse in Enugu
Police Operatives serving in the Nsukka Sector of the Enugu State Command’s Anti-Cultism Tactical Squad, have arrested a ‘’masquerade” popularly called Oriokpa, caught on tape physically assaulting a female victim at Ugwuoye Junction, Nsukka.
The man behind the masquerade costume was later identified as Ugwuoke Ebube “m”, aged 22, of Enugu Road, Nsukka.
A statement released by DSP Daniel Ndukwe, says an investigation into the case suggests that the suspect was part of a group of masqueraders that similarly assaulted a female nurse riding a motorcycle, as captured in a viral video in April 2024. He was arraigned in the Nsukka Magistrate Court of Enugu State, Nigeria on Wednesday, May 22, 2024, but was granted bail by the court.

Ndukwe mentioned that the state Commissioner of Police, CP Kanayo Uzuegbu while condemning the act, has warned those intending to hide under the guise of culturally celebrating masquerades to commit such criminal acts of assault against fellow citizens to desist forthwith. He stressed that the Command will henceforth not hesitate to bring anyone found wanting to book, just as in the case at hand.
